Profile of Midwest University

The campus of Midwest University is in Wentzville, MO, which is a rural site not far from an urban area. Its Interdenominational nature is one of the defining aspects of the school. Midwest University is a private, not-for-profit institution. Degrees at the school include, at the school's highest level, the Doctoral degree.

Course Topics

Midwest University is known for its programs in religion and philosophy.

Midwest University Selectivity

Admission at the school is selective, not open to all who apply. Getting into Midwest University is challenging; it only admitted 40% of those who applied in 2007.

Student Enrolment

In 2007, the school had 376 students enrolled (294 full-time equivalent). Midwest University has a large minority student population. A large number of students at the school are 40 years old or older.

Student Life

Full-time students are the norm at Midwest University. The school offers students meal plans.
